How to quickly generate random data in Python?

As data analysts, we often need to generate random data for testing and simulation, but manually generating data is time-consuming and error-prone. Today I will introduce some techniques for quickly generating random data in Python.

# 首先,我们需要导入random库。
import random
import string


# #生成1-100之间的随机整数
random.randint(1, 100)  

#  #生成0-1之间的随机小数
random.uniform(0, 1) 

#  #生成10位随机字符串
''.join(random.choice('abcdefghijklmnopqrstuvwxyz') for i in range(10)) 

# #生成一个随机的英文字母
random.choice(string.ascii_lowercase)  

Guess you like

Origin blog.csdn.net/xili1342/article/details/130085294